Renewed strike in Germany affects freight train traffic

According to provided information, the German Train Drivers' Union (GDL) has announced a new strike at DB Cargo, scheduled to commence at 18:00 on Tuesday, January 23, 2024. This will impact all DB companies, including infrastructure and City-Bahn Chemnitz, starting at 02:00 on Wednesday, January 24. The strike is expected to conclude at 18:00 on Monday, January 29.

This strike will affect the network of DB Cargo AG and parts of Green Cargo's international traffic. It is anticipated to primarily impact Green Cargo's international transports with potential delays and cancellations. In response to this situation, Green Cargo has implemented a dispatch ban for all export volumes via Malmö.

Force Majeure is invoked for all traffic affected by the strike announced by the German Train Drivers' Union GDL, starting at 18:00 on January 23, 2024. Green Cargo is closely monitoring the ongoing situation and maintaining close contact with DB Cargo AG, ensuring continuous updates on specific effects on our rail transports.
